A Brand New Consumer Marketing Platform
Building on Hong Kong's culinary strength and the exemption of wine duty, as well as the introduction of the Michelin Guide - Hong Kong, the Hong Kong Tourism Board (HKTB) has adopted the 'Hong Kong Food and Wine Year' as the marketing platform for 2009 to further highlight Hong Kong's position as one of the leading culinary and wine hubs in Asia. A series of gastronomical events featuring fine wine, food, festivities and fun will be organised from April 2009 to March 2010 with an aim to providing an opportunity for visitors to experience and enjoy a world of food and wine in Hong Kong.
 
 

The First Ever Outdoor Wine & Dine Festival
The first ever Hong Kong Wine and Dine Festival, a festive, upscale event showcasing wines from national and international wineries paired with food from local restaurants and culinary personalities will be held between 30 October – 1 November 2009, at the best vantage point for the world renowned Victoria Harbour. This three-day event will be a spectacular gathering of wine, food, music and fun. Thousands of wine lovers will flock to this festival making this one of the most desirable wine consumer event of the year, where people can savour familiar wines, while enjoying the opportunity to discover new favourites from many brilliant wineries from all over the world, in one single place.
